Description
The Leipheimer Moos is a beautiful moorland with wide areas for Лунь очеретяний as well as the rare Деркач лучний, Жовта плиска, Кобилочка-цвіркун and migratory Щеврик лучний. In the reed areas north of the border ditch Синьошийка likes to sing, in the cattle pastures Трав'янка чорноголова and along the boardwalk circuit (the boardwalk itself is unfortunately closed) Крутиголовка звичайна, Соловейко західний, Баранець звичайний, Чайка чубата, Кропив’янка сіра, Зозуля звичайна, Фазан and Жовна чорна can be heard or seen.
Also worth a visit in autumn/winter when there are Лунь польовий, Сірий (Великий) сорокопуд, Сова болотяна, Гуска білолоба and Журавель сірий.

Access
The Leipheimer Moos is located in north of the town of Günzburg. The area is perfect to explore by bike and on foot. You can park your car south of the area at the Herdweg parking area in Leipheim.
